Quote:
Originally Posted by Brian Carlton View Post
Total of 26 screws.........get all of them and the head will lift........but, it's not easy without a hoist.
Its not that heavy, I lifted it right off myself without a problem. Then again, I am exceptionally strong, if I tried real hard, I could probably pull the head off without removing the bolts first. J/K


The head weighs probably like 110lbs or so bare.....I was able to carry it around holding onto the oil feed line on top. Now the block is another thing....my dad and I were able to lift it up onto our trailer together, that thing is HEAVY. At the scrap yard the block + head weighed in around 400lbs....and that's bare, no manifolds, valve cover, rockers, pulley, accessories or anything. Just the bare block + pistons and crankshaft.
